Project Type Typical Range
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air $1,200 - $3,000
Concrete Slab Leveling $2,000 - $4,500
Foundation Underpinning $4,500 - $8,500
Basement Wall Stabilization $3,000 - $7,000
Crawl Space Stabilization $2,000 - $5,000
Structural Reinforcement $3,500 - $7,500

Factors Affecting Cost

Home foundation leveling in Marshall County, IN, involves adjusting and stabilizing a home's foundation to address uneven settling or shifting. This process helps maintain the structural integrity of the property and can prevent future issues related to foundation movement. Understanding typical project components can assist homeowners in planning and comparing options for foundation repair services.

  • Materials: Common materials include concrete piers, steel supports, and mudjacking foam, selected based on foundation type and soil conditions.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from minor adjustments under specific areas to extensive underpinning of the entire foundation, depending on the level of settling.
  • Labor Complexity: The process involves excavation, precise placement of supports, and soil stabilization, requiring skilled labor and specialized equipment.
  • Permitting: Local permits may be necessary for foundation work, especially for larger projects or when structural modifications are involved.
  • Additional Options: Some projects may include waterproofing, drainage improvements, or foundation crack repair as part of the overall stabilization plan.

Project Size & Details

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small residential adjustments $1,000 - $3,000
Moderate foundation lifts $3,000 - $7,000
Large or complex projects $7,000 - $15,000
Additional repairs (cracks, settling) $500 - $2,000

Project costs in Marshall County, IN, can vary based on specific site conditions and the extent of foundation adjustments needed.
